By Belize Live News Staff: Authorities in Ladyville Village are investigating a burglary at a residence in Vista Del Mar that occurred sometime between Monday evening and Tuesday afternoon. The incident was reported by a relative, who discovered the theft while the homeowner was away.
The perpetrator(s) reportedly gained entry by breaking a glass window on the western side of the elevated wooden house. Once inside, the thieves made off with several items, including a black crock pot valued at $95, a trimming machine set worth $75, two empty 5-gallon crystal water bottles priced at $25 each, a roll of duct tape valued at $10, and various grocery items. The total estimated loss is around $230.
The homeowner has not been seen since early January, raising additional concerns. Police are investigating and are urging anyone with information about the incident to contact the Ladyville Police Station.
Authorities are encouraging residents to report suspicious activity and to take preventative measures to secure their homes. Investigations into the incident are ongoing.
